The renewal of our three-year agreement with Torvane Materials has been assessed in detail. Proposed terms include a 4.2% unit-price increase, partially offset by improved volume rebates and extended payment terms of sixty days. Sensitivity analysis indicates a net annual cost impact of under 1% on the Meridia product line, assuming stable demand. Legal has flagged no material changes to liability clauses. We recommend approval, subject to the conditions outlined in the confidential note below.

confidential, yawip-bahif: Zorokox Partners plans to lower the Casax list price by 28.0 percent in April. The board signed off on a budget of $271.0 million for Project Juldor. The renewal with Pelokox Partners closes at $410.1 million a year, 3.4 percent below the last contract. Project Pelok slips by a full year because of the audit delay.

## Configuration — Upstream Circuit Breaker (Gatewick)

The breaker guards calls to the Fennor pricing API. BREAKER_FAILURE_THRESHOLD (default 5) and BREAKER_RESET_SECONDS (default 30) control trip and recovery; half-open probes are capped at 2. All values load from the env file at boot; no runtime overrides. Probe requests authenticate upstream, so the env file sets the probe credential on the next line.

vault entry, yajop-bafop: ARCHIVE_KEY3=8d4

**Action:** The Larkspur audit missed low-contrast states on Mosswood's disabled buttons because our checker only sampled default themes. Fix: run the contrast pass against every theme variant in CI and fail the build below threshold. Reviewer, please confirm the ratios match our accessibility spec. The enforced minimums are listed below.

tuning table, faduf-baduf:
PRIORITIES = {
    "ulavan": 191,
    "silys": 750,
    "goriel": 238,
    "kelmir": 66,
    "wendor": 432,
}

## v5.2.1 — Tile cache key rotation

Heads up, support folks: we rotated the credentials for the Maplight tile-rendering cache. Some users may see slow map loads for ~15 minutes post-deploy while the cache warms back up — that's expected, no ticket needed. Old tokens stop working today.

If you're helping ops verify the rollout, the new signing key is:

signing key of tagag-faweg = bky9_RpGGMK6ab